Molecular class

DAC-modified GHRH analog

Sequence / composition

A substituted GHRH 1-29-style peptide linked to a Drug Affinity Complex designed for albumin association.

Research design note

The DAC attachment, rather than the name alone, distinguishes the expected exposure profile from a no-DAC construct.
